noncomprehending Definition
not understanding or grasping the meaning of something.

Summary: noncomprehending in Brief
The term 'noncomprehending' [non-kom-pri-hen-ding] is an adjective used to describe someone who does not understand or grasp the meaning of something. It is often used to describe a person's facial expression or response to a situation, as in 'The noncomprehending look on his face made it clear that he had no idea what was going on.' Synonyms include 'uncomprehending,' 'bewildered,' and 'confused.'
